The Iran national futsal team represents Iran in international futsal competitions and is controlled by the Futsal Commission of the Islamic Republic of Iran Football Federation. It is by far the strongest team in Asia, the nine times champion in Asian Futsal Championship.[1] As of December 2007, Iran is ranked 6 in the Futsal World Ranking, the highest ranking Asian team in the latest World Rankings.[2]

Iran has played in four FIFA Futsal World Championships. Its best result was the fourth place in 1992 in Hong Kong.[3]
